## Build Provenance: Image Slimming for Larkmoor Services

Welcome aboard. Every slimmed container image in the Larkmoor pipeline must retain a verifiable link to its unslimmed parent. When we strip debug tooling and locale data from a base image, the slimmer records the exact layer digests removed and the policy version used. Never slim an image manually; always go through the Pruner stage so provenance attestations stay intact. Before signing off on any slimmed artifact, confirm the trace token recorded by the Pruner, shown here.

session token of fawep-tajep = htk14_4221f8eaf43a2f

## Crash Pipeline: batching and retry fixes

This PR stabilizes the Larkspur crash-report pipeline for the Pebblenote mobile app. Reports are now batched before upload, and the retry loop backs off exponentially instead of hammering the ingest node. QA on the Fernvale staging cluster shows a 40% drop in duplicate reports. No schema changes; safe to ship in the next train. The tuning constants are as follows.

tuning constants:
QUOTAS = {
    "druwyn": 5,
    "holix": 5,
    "zorath": 5,
    "holwyn": 10,
}

For the incoming director: the licensing dispute with Tarnell Systems over the Quillbright codec remains unresolved entering Q3. Tarnell asserts our Harrowmere release exceeds the field-of-use terms; our counsel disagrees but recommends a negotiated settlement to avoid injunction risk in the Velder market. Budget impact is provisioned. Engineering has a workaround ready in eleven weeks if talks fail, though at some performance cost. Please treat the settlement posture as sensitive. The confidential note below describes our intended strategy.

confidential, yajof-fadug: Project Julvan slips by one quarter because of the audit delay.

Notes – print run, Kestrel catalogue

Master copies for the Kestrel autumn catalogue go to Dunmore Print Works tomorrow. Shift lead to pull the sealed tube from the locked cage, check the seal is intact, and stage it at the dock by 07:30. No photocopies, no opening the tube. Courier from Redgate Express arrives between 08:00 and 08:30. If seal looks tampered, hold the shipment and call the studio. Sign the transfer log both ways. Confidential courier hand-over instruction is below.

handover note for yagef-bagep: the drudor pelius courier leaves the kasdor zorvan norir ledger at gate 8016 under passcode 755406